What Actually Determines Payout Speed

When you hit the withdrawal button, your request does not vanish into a void. It lands in a queue, and the operator’s finance team will typically review it before releasing the funds. This is the “pending period” โ€” a window that exists to catch chargebacks, fraud and mistaken deposits. On well-run sites, that review takes minutes rather than hours. On slower operations, it stretches to 24 or even 72 hours, often because the request lands on a Friday afternoon and sits through the weekend.

The second factor is the payment rail itself. E-wallets like PayPal or Skrill move money almost instantly once the casino releases it, because they operate on a closed loop between the operator and the wallet provider. Debit cards take a little longer, as the transaction has to travel through the card networks. Bank transfers are the slowest, often requiring manual processing on the bank’s side. None of this is within the casino’s control after release โ€” but a smart player chooses the rail that matches their patience.

Finally, verification status. If your identity documents are already on file and approved, a withdrawal sails through. If they are not, the operator is legally required to check your identity before paying out โ€” and that check can take a day or two. The single biggest lever you have is to complete verification before you ever request a withdrawal. The payments and payouts landscape rewards preparation more than luck.

Method-by-Method Timelines

Timelines vary by operator, but the realistic picture for a UKGC-licensed site looks like this. E-wallets are the gold standard: once the casino releases your funds, the money typically appears in your wallet within minutes, sometimes within an hour. Debit cards sit in the middle โ€” release is usually same-day if requested early, but the card network can add a business day before the funds appear on your balance. Bank transfers are the tortoise of the group, routinely taking two to five business days depending on your bank’s processing schedule.

Payment method Typical release time Typical arrival time
E-wallet (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ller) Under 1 hour Minutes after release
Debit card (Visa, Mastercard) Under 24 hours 1โ€“3 business days
Bank transfer Under 24 hours 2โ€“5 business days
Prepaid / voucher Under 24 hours Varies by provider

Note that these are typical figures, not guarantees. Operators set their own terms, and those terms change โ€” always check the current cashier page before assuming a timeline. The pattern, though, is consistent: if speed matters, e-wallets beat cards, and cards beat bank transfers. One caveat worth flagging is that some operators restrict withdrawals to the method you used to deposit. If you funded your account with a debit card, you may be forced to withdraw back to that same card, which rules out the faster e-wallet route. Read the cashier terms before you deposit, not after you win.

Verification Done Right

Verification is the silent killer of fast payouts. Under UKGC rules, operators must confirm your identity before they pay out, and they must do it again if your circumstances change. The process usually involves proof of identity โ€” a passport or driving licence โ€” and proof of address, such as a recent utility bill or bank statement. Some sites also ask for proof of payment method, like a photo of your card with the middle digits obscured, or a screenshot of your e-wallet account details.

The checks trigger at different moments. Some operators verify when you register, others when you make your first deposit, and still others only when you request a withdrawal. If you have played for weeks without verification, the first withdrawal request can stall while the documents are reviewed. The fix is simple: upload your documents the day you sign up, even if the site does not ask for them yet. Many operators have a “verify my account” section in the cashier or account settings. Use it.

There is a second, subtler layer. If you win a substantial amount, the operator may conduct an enhanced due-diligence check, which can involve confirming the source of your funds. This is rare but legitimate, and it is why large withdrawals occasionally take longer even on fast sites. If your documents are clean and your history is consistent, this check usually completes within a day. If you have been playing with multiple cards or switching payment methods, the check takes longer. Keep your payment methods stable, and your withdrawal history will thank you.

Pending Periods, Reversals and Weekends

The pending period is the time between your withdrawal request and the operator actually sending the money. On fast payout casino sites, that period is often zero โ€” the funds are released immediately. On others, it is a fixed window of 24 or 48 hours, during which you can cancel the withdrawal and put the money back into your playable balance. This “reverse withdrawal” feature is a double-edged sword. It protects you from impulse requests you later regret, but it also creates a temptation to gamble away what you meant to cash out.

In Great Britain, the reverse-withdrawal feature is governed by commercial terms rather than law, so availability varies by operator. Some sites offer it only on the first withdrawal of the day, others allow it throughout the pending window. The key is to know your own tendencies. If you are prone to reversing a withdrawal after a bad beat, consider choosing a site that releases funds immediately, removing the option entirely.

Weekends are where most payout promises go to die. Many operators process withdrawals on business days only, so a Friday afternoon request can pend until Monday morning. E-wallet providers, however, operate around the clock โ€” so if your operator releases on a Saturday and you use PayPal or Skrill, the money can still land within the hour. The smart play is to request withdrawals early in the week, and to use an e-wallet if you are cashing out on a Friday. Operator Comparison on Real Payout Behaviour

Rather than trusting marketing copy, look at how operators behave in practice. The UK market has a strong crop of established names, each with its own payout personality. Bet365, for instance, is known for processing withdrawals quickly once verification is complete, with e-wallet payouts often landing within the hour. Smarkets, primarily a betting exchange, runs a tight ship on finance and generally releases funds promptly. Betvictor has a solid reputation for paying out without unnecessary friction, particularly on its casino side.

Operator Typical pending time Payout behaviour
Bet365 Under 1 hour E-wallets land quickly; verification required upfront
Smarkets Under 2 hours Clean finance desk; occasional enhanced checks on large wins
Betvictor Under 24 hours Reliable release; slower on bank transfers
Virgin Games Under 24 hours Steady processing; good for debit card users
Hollywoodbets Under 24 hours Consistent; weekend releases less frequent

Other operators in the mix deserve a mention for their approach. Lottomart and Magical Vegas both operate on platforms that release funds quickly, though their withdrawal limits can be modest. DragonBet, a Welsh operator, has built a loyal following for its straightforward terms and honest payout behaviour. Double Bubble Bingo and talkSPORT BET cater to different audiences but share a common trait: they pay out what they owe without theatrics. The common thread across all of these names is that none of them promise literal instant withdrawals, because no UKGC-licensed operator can. What they offer is speed measured in hours rather than days โ€” and that is the realistic meaning of “instant” in 2026.

Can withdrawal limits be raised at an instant withdrawal casino?

Most operators set maximum withdrawal limits per transaction or per day, often in the range of ยฃ5,000 to ยฃ10,000. If you win above that limit, the excess is usually paid in scheduled instalments over several days. You can sometimes request a higher limit for a single withdrawal by contacting support, especially if your account is fully verified and your play history is clean โ€” but there is no guarantee, and the operator’s terms take precedence.

Is it normal for a withdrawal to be declined without explanation?

A declined withdrawal usually points to a rule you missed rather than a fault in the system. The most common causes are unmet wagering requirements on a bonus, a withdrawal method that differs from your deposit method, or a verification document that has expired. Check your bonus terms first, then contact live chat with your account details โ€” most declines are resolved within a single conversation once the cause is identified.

What happens if I request a withdrawal on a Saturday?

Your request will be logged, but it may not be processed until the next business day, which in the UK means Monday morning. If the operator uses an e-wallet and processes over the weekend, the money can land within hours โ€” but that is the exception rather than the rule. To avoid the weekend lag entirely, request your withdrawal on a Tuesday or Wednesday, when processing desks are fully staffed and payment rails are at their most responsive.

Do all casinos hold withdrawals for 24 hours?

No. The pending period is a commercial term set by each operator, not a legal requirement. Some sites release funds immediately, while others hold for 24 or 48 hours to allow for reversal requests. The quickest way to find out is to check the cashier page before you deposit โ€” if the pending period is not stated clearly, ask support. A straight answer is a good sign; a vague one is a warning.
